Ticket: Evacuation-chair store, Stairwell B landing, Level 3, Okeford House. The store cupboard has been restocked and the chair inspected following last month's drill. Team assistants should check the seal monthly and log it on the wall sheet. The cupboard is now keypad-locked to prevent tampering; the access code is given below.

badge for fafop-fajof: bdg-Z-47

**Ticket: Watering scheduler failing auth since 02:10**

The Sproutline scheduler stopped dispatching valve-open commands overnight. Logs show 401s from the irrigation control service — the service credential expired yesterday and auto-renewal never fired. Plants in greenhouse zones 3–5 are overdue. A fresh key has been issued and verified against staging. Update the scheduler's secret store with the key below.

gateway credential: qvz4-W8Ni

### v2.8.1 — Connection pooling

Replaced per-request connections in Marrowbase with a shared pool (min 5, max 40, idle timeout 90s). Leaked handles are now logged and reclaimed after 30 seconds. Load tests on the Driftholm cluster show p95 latency down 38%. Reviewers should focus on the shutdown drain logic. Questions about the pooling design should be directed to the author identified below.

named custodian: Brivan Eliath Quenox Frador

## Formula sandbox tuning

User-supplied formulas in Gridmoor execute inside a restricted interpreter with hard ceilings on time, memory, and call depth. Reviewers should confirm any change to these ceilings is justified in the PR description, since raising them widens the abuse surface. Defaults were chosen from production traces. The current limits are as follows.

limits module of tafog-fawip:
WEIGHTS = {
    "julix": 57,
    "lamys": 992,
    "kasvan": 209,
    "quenok": 750,
    "alddor": 259,
    "oliath": 1009,
    "wenix": 815,
}